Ti25Ta is an excellent biological alloy that is not only non-toxic, has high specific strength, strong wear and corrosion resistance, but also has a lower elastic modulus of about 64 GPa compared to Ti-6Al-4V and pure titanium. It is considered a highly promising new generation bone implant material.

TiAl4822 Spherical Titanium Aluminum Alloy Powder
Titanium aluminum alloy (TiAl4822) has excellent properties such as low density, high modulus, good high-temperature strength, creep resistance, oxidation resistance, flame retardancy, low thermal expansion rate, and thermal conductivity. It has broad application prospects in the fields of automotive engine turbocharged turbines, aerospace engines, and rocket propulsion systems, and is an attractive new generation of lightweight, high-strength, and high-temperature structural materials.
